CVE-2021-46079 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 7.2/10 on the CVSS scale. An Unrestricted File Upload vulnerability exists in Sourcecodester Vehicle Service Management System 1.0. A remote attacker can upload malicious files leading to Html Injection.. EPSS estimates a 3.31%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
